5 of 5 stars Reviewed 5 April 2012

Run by a Dutch couple who speak excellent English Robert and Linda de Beer, for ca 3 years. Room for up to 18 people in large old but well-maintained house and neighboring structure on the Tet river a short walk from town. Very friendly couple, nice room with fast wi fi, good breakfast. they have good ideas for local sightseeing,... More

4 of 5 stars Reviewed 23 September 2011

Linda and Robert with 2 boys and 3 cats, plus dog (Igor) and horse (Taris), are a lovely family with a wonderful house on the riverbank. They serve up very generous family style hospitality, and all family and guests eat together at a large table. They gave us beer and wine on our arrival with no charge. We had room... More
